Background technique
Ball mill is the key equipment that material is broken and then is crushed.This seed type ore mill is in its cylinder
It is interior to be packed into a certain number of steel balls as abrasive media.It is widely used in cement, silicate product, New Building Materials, resistance to
The production industries such as fiery material, chemical fertilizer, black and non-ferrous metal ore and glass ceramics, to various ores and other grindability materials
Carry out dry type or wet type grinding.Ball mill is suitable for the various ores of grinding and other materials, is widely used in ore dressing, building materials and change
The industries such as work can be divided into two kinds of grinding modes of dry type and wet type.It is different according to ore discharge mode, it can lattice subtype and overflow type two
Kind.Ball mill is by horizontal cylinder, input and output material hollow shaft and mill first class sections composition, and cylinder is long cylinder, and cylinder is provided with
Abrasive body, cylinder are steel plate manufacture, have steel liner plate to fix with cylinder, and abrasive body is generally steel ball, and presses different-diameter
It is fitted into cylinder with certain proportion, abrasive body can also use steel section.Selected according to the granularity of grinding material, material by ball mill into
Expect that end hollow shaft is packed into cylinder, when ball mill barrel rotation, abrasive body since inertia and centrifugal force act on, frictional force
Effect, is attached to it on shell liner and is taken away by cylinder, when being brought to certain height, due to the gravity of itself
And left, the grinding body image projectile of whereabouts is equally smashed the intracorporal material of cylinder.
